🚨SIDS RESEARCH 🚨

PLEASE understand that while a correlation has been made regarding SIDS deaths and enzymes in the infant’s blood, there were extreme limiting factors in this study.

While it definitely is a step in the right direction, it has not been deemed an exact cause.
There is currently no way to test your baby for this enzyme.

AND IT DOES NOT CHANGE SAFE SLEEP RULES.

Suffocation is still a great risk, asphyxiation is still a great risk, strangulation and entrapments are still great risks.

Place your baby, on their back, in their bassinet/crib/pnp, with nothing but a paci if needed.

Babies who die while cosleeping rarely die of SIDS or SUIDS, they die from the tragedies I listed above.

formula recall alert!!!

Important recall information on commonly used US infant formulas including Similac, Alimentum, and EleCare. Please check your formula at the link below.

Abbott has issued a recall of powder formulas, including Similac®, Alimentum® and EleCare® manufactured in Sturgis, Mich., one of the company’s manufacturing facilities. Abbott is voluntarily recalling these products after four consumer complaints related to Cronobacter sakazakii or Salmonella Newport in infants who had consumed powder infant formula manufactured in this facility. Current investigation is ongoing.

🍕 If you had or plan to have a hospital birth, you probably have heard the rule that you can’t eat anything once in labor.

🍔 This rule was set based off of old (1994), and much more dangerous anesthesia. As we know, western medicine has come a long way in the last 27 years. Then, aspiration was an incredible issue during surgery under general anasthesia, and could result in infection and possibly death.

🌮 In 2021, general anesthesia during labor is only given in the event of an emergency cesarean, if the patient does not already have an epidural placed.

🌯 It has been found that food consumption during labor can shorten labor by close to 20 minutes. Additionally, higher maternal satisfaction rate is reported by those allowed solid food throughout the labor process vs those only allowed water and ice (97% vs 55%).

🍩 In the UK, where birthing parents are encouraged to eat and drink as they please during the labor process; there was only one aspiration related death in over 6 million births between 2000 and 2008.

🌭 Finally, hospital policy does not bind patients and they do not have the legal authority to prevent patients from eating and drinking. So eat that hamburger, and see the link below for more information!

As promised, here is the most recent update from TriCare regarding the Doula Demonstration beginning next year! It is a lot of information, I have done my best to summarize it below.

This demo recognizes the benefits a Doula can have both emotionally and physically for a pregnant person, their family, and their birth outcomes. It will begin 1 January 2022 and continue for 5 years. When those 5 years are up, the program will be re-evaluated.

TriCare Prime and TriCare Select beneficiaries who are currently stationed in the Continental United States are eligible for Labor Support and Lactation Consultations. Beneficiaries must be 20+ weeks pregnant and must plan to deliver the baby with a TriCare authorized provider, with emergency cases possibly being an exception. This includes home-births, birth center births, and hospital births! **I am looking for clarification but the website reads as if the member must be delivering OFF BASE and not in an MTF**

The Doula may charge TriCare directly, or the beneficiary may pay out of pocket and then file for a reimbursement. The coverage will include 6 (total) prenatal and postpartum meetings (max charge of $46 each) and 1 event of continuous labor support (max charge of $690).

Of course, TriCare has set some prerequisites for Doulas before they are able to become TriCare approved:
- Certified with a TriCare approved organization
- Attend a minimum of 24 hours of training that meets TriCare regulations
- Attend a breastfeeding course
- Attend a Childbirth Education Course
- Have attended minimum of 3 births, in the last 3 years. 2 of them must be vaginal births.
- Provide prenatal and postpartum support for at least 1 family in the last 3 years.
- Infant, child, and adult CPR Certification
- License or certification for applicable states
- NPI number

At Utz Doula Services, we are committed to sharing evidence based information with our clients. With that being said, we are starting a new series called Myth 🆚 Fact!

I often see posts comparing a newborn stomach to a cherry and warning against overfeeding as it will “stretch out” the baby’s stomach. 🍒

The reality is, this is outdated and false information that can also turn dangerous. ⚠️

In the NICU, full term babies are fed based on their weight. A 6.6 lb baby needs 2-3 oz of breastmilk or formula every 2-3 hours. 🍼

Babies should be fed on demand, until they are satisfied. If you are worried if they are getting enough, pay attention to their wet and dirty diaper output. 💩

A baby’s belly is meant to stretch, just like adults. Babies will rest better, regulate their blood sugar easier, and return to birth weight faster when they are receiving an adequate amount of milk. 👩‍🍼

You might recall my post regarding the FDA warning letter being sent to Owlet regarding the SmartSock. Owlet has announced that they will no longer be selling the SmartSock and plan to work towards FDA approval.

If you have an Owlet SmartSock, I encourage you to reach out to the company for a refund of some sort!

These things don’t prevent SIDS, they have burned babies, and they have extremely low levels before even alerting IF they alert.

https://owletcare.com/pages/fda-response?fbclid=IwAR0wdO_sJbryuGiBb_mfA2FPZry1p5JBBxcMjtsGm1FE_a8_OHkvVxkva0M

Remember that the ABCs of Safe Sleep are the safest option for infant sleep; ALONE on their BACK in the CRIB (bassinet and packnplay are also safe).
